Babar Ali: The Young Guardian

In the rural Bengal, a beacon of hope emerged in the form of Babar Ali, who, at the tender age of nine, became a teacher. With unwavering determination, he illuminated the lives of slum-living children, providing them the gift of education – a treasure as precious as life itself.

Gautam Buddha and Chanakya: Ancient Wisdom in Modern Context

From the ancient India, the teachings of Gautam Buddha and Chanakya continue to inspire. Buddha’s profound wisdom illuminated the path to enlightenment, emphasizing compassion and inner peace. Chanakya, the ancient strategist, philosopher, and royal advisor, authored the Arthashastra, leaving behind a legacy of statecraft and ethical governance that resonates with the ideals of World Teachers Day.

Remembering Dr. Sarvepalli Radhakrishnan: A Philosopher-Statesman

A philosopher, statesman, and the second President of India, Dr. Sarvepalli Radhakrishnan’s contributions to education are immeasurable. His vision transcended boundaries, emphasizing the importance of knowledge, virtue, and enlightenment in shaping a nation’s destiny, a vision celebrated on World Teachers Day.

Swami Vivekananda: Architect of Modern Education

Swami Vivekananda, the spiritual luminary, envisioned education as a holistic tool for character building. He propagated the Gurukula system, emphasizing the harmony of mental, physical, and spiritual development – a vision in line with the values of World Teachers Day.

Madan Mohan Malviya and Rabindranath Tagore: Pillars of Learning

Madan Mohan Malviya, the freedom fighter and educationist, founded Banaras Hindu University, an institution that stands tall as a testament to his vision of accessible education, a vision celebrated on World Teachers Day. Rabindranath Tagore, the poet, philosopher, and founder of Visva-Bharati University, advocated for an education system rooted in creativity, freedom, and individuality, echoing the spirit of Teachers Day.

Anand Kumar: Empowering Through Mathematics

Anand Kumar’s Super 30 program has been a hope for underprivileged students aspiring to crack the prestigious IIT-JEE exams. His dedication to nurturing young minds, irrespective of their social standing, has transformed dreams into tangible success stories, a reflection of the values upheld on World Teachers Day.
